5 Figure 4 In vivo, plasma carnitine concentration is correlated with the QT interval duration. A–D: Effects of MET88 treatment on RR interval (panel A), PR interval (panel B), QRS complex duration (panel C), and QT interval duration (panel D). ***P < .001; N = 12. E: Typical electrocardiograms before and after MET88 treatment. F: Correlation between the plasma carnitine concentration and the QT interval (r = 0.73; P < .01). 6 Figure 5 Arrhythmic events recorded after 28 days of MET88 treatment. Different kinds of arrhythmias were recorded (indicated by arrows) under basal conditions (blank column) and after MET88 treatment (filled column). A and B: Single premature ventricular beats. C and D: Salvos of premature ventricular beats. E and F: Episode of sustained ventricular tachycardia. G and H: Ventricular fibrillation events were counted. **P < .005; ***P < .001; N = 10.
